When comparing trading costs for Libya traders, IG and Admirals have distinct fee structures. IG charges spreads starting from 0.6 pips on its standard account for major forex pairs like EUR/USD, with no commission on most instruments. For high-volume traders, IG offers a Raw Spread account with spreads from 0.0 pips but a commission of $3 per lot per side. Admirals provides a Zero account with spreads from 0.0 pips and a commission of $2 per lot per side, making it cheaper for active traders. On the standard account, Admirals' spreads average around 0.8 pips. For Libya traders trading in USD, the difference in spreads can significantly impact profitability, especially for scalpers or those trading large volumes. It's advisable to compare live spreads on both platforms before committing.

Both brokers offer powerful trading platforms tailored to Libya traders' needs. IG provides its proprietary web platform, MetaTrader 4 (MT4), and ProRealTime, all with advanced charting, automated trading, and risk management tools. The IG platform is known for its intuitive interface and integration with TradingView charts. Admirals offers MT4, MT5, and its own WebTrader, with a focus on simplicity and speed. For Libya traders, MT4 and MT5 are particularly popular due to their reliability and support for Expert Advisors (EAs). IG's platform is better suited for traders who want extensive customization and research tools, while Admirals' platforms are more straightforward and faster for execution. Both are compatible with desktop, web, and mobile devices.

For Muslim traders in Libya who require Sharia-compliant trading, both IG and Admirals offer Islamic (swap-free) accounts. These accounts do not charge overnight interest or swap fees on positions held beyond one trading day, in accordance with Islamic finance principles. IG provides Islamic accounts upon request for eligible clients, with no additional fees for the swap-free feature. Admirals offers Islamic accounts automatically for clients who request them, with the same conditions. It's important to note that Islamic accounts may have different terms for long-term positions, such as administrative fees after a certain period. Both brokers are suitable for Libyan Muslim traders, but Admirals' automatic provision may be more convenient.
